In right triangle ABC, ∠C is a right angle and sin A = sin B. What is m∠A?

A and B are the two acute angles of a right triangle, so they add up to 90 degrees. If their sines are equal then the angles themselves are equal. Each one is half of 90 degrees = 45 degrees.
